Formula for Calculating the Volume of a Cylinder

The formula for calculating the volume of a cylinder is:

V = πr2h

Where V is the volume, r is the radius of the cylinder, and h is the height of the cylinder. The symbol π represents the mathematical constant pi, which is approximately equal to 3.14159.

Step-by-Step Guide to Calculating the Volume of a Cylinder

Step 1: Measure the Radius and Height of the Cylinder

The first step in calculating the volume of a cylinder is to measure its radius and height. The radius is the distance from the center of the cylinder to its edge, and the height is the distance from one end of the cylinder to the other.

For example, let's say you have a cylinder with a radius of 5 cm and a height of 10 cm.

Step 2: Calculate the Area of the Base

The next step is to calculate the area of the base of the cylinder. The base of a cylinder is a circle, and its area is calculated using the formula:

A = πr2

Using our example, the area of the base of the cylinder is:

A = 3.14159 x 52 = 78.53975 cm2

Step 3: Multiply the Area of the Base by the Height

The final step is to multiply the area of the base by the height of the cylinder to get the volume. Using our example, the volume of the cylinder is:

V = 78.53975 x 10 = 785.3975 cm3

Converting Cubic Centimeters to Liters

In most cases, it is more convenient to express the volume of a cylinder in liters rather than cubic centimeters. To convert cubic centimeters to liters, you can divide the volume by 1000.

Using our example, the volume of the cylinder in liters is:

V = 785.3975 / 1000 = 0.7854 liters

Applications of Cylinder Volume Calculations

Calculating the volume of a cylinder is an important task in various fields. For example, in engineering and architecture, cylinder volume calculations are used to determine the capacity of pipes and tanks. In physics, cylinder volume calculations are used to determine the amount of gas or liquid that can be contained in a cylinder.
